We launched new forums in March 2019—join us there. In a hurry for help with your website? Get Help Now!
    • 23050
    • 1,842 Posts
    Hello,

    Auto-responder email is not sent to @fiarFrom . I needed to change emailsender in modx config on order the mail is sent at good e-mail.

    Here is my call :

    [[!FormIt?
       &hooks=`spam,email,FormItAutoResponder,redirect`
       &emailTpl=`formitContactMailTPL`
       &emailSubject=`Nouveau contact depuis le site`
       &emailTo=`[email protected]`
       &emailFromName=`noname`
       &fiarTpl=`formitContactFiarTPL`
       &fiarSubject=`Votre message`
       &fiarFrom=`[email protected]`
       &fiarFromName=`noname`
       &redirectTo=`21`
       &validate=`nom:required,
          email:email:required,
          message:required:stripTags,
          telephone:required`
    ]]
    
    [[!+fi.error_message:notempty=`<p>[[!+fi.error_message]]</p>`]]
     
    <form action="[[~[[*id]]]]" method="post" class="form">
        <input type="hidden" name="nospam:blank" value="" />
     
        <div class="champ">
          <label for="nom"><span class="req">*</span>Nom : 
              <span class="error">[[!+fi.error.nom]]</span>
          </label>
          <input type="text" name="nom" id="nom" value="[[!+fi.nom]]" />
        </div>
     
        <div class="champ">
          <label for="prenom">Prénom : 
          </label>
          <input type="text" name="prenom" id="prenom" value="[[!+fi.prenom]]" />
        </div>
     
        <div class="champ">
          <label for="telephone"><span class="req">*</span>Téléphone : 
              <span class="error">[[!+fi.error.telephone]]</span>
          </label>
          <input type="text" name="telephone" id="telephone" value="[[!+fi.telephone]]" />
        </div>
    
        <div class="champ">
          <label for="ville">Ville : 
          </label>
          <input type="text" name="ville" id="ville" value="[[!+fi.ville]]" />
        </div>
    
        <div class="champ">
          <label for="cp">Code Postal : 
          </label>
          <input type="text" name="cp" id="cp" value="[[!+fi.cp]]" />
        </div>
     
        <div class="champ">
          <label for="email"><span class="req">*</span>E-mail : 
              <span class="error">[[!+fi.error.email]]</span>
          </label>
          <input type="text" name="email" id="email" value="[[!+fi.email]]" />
        </div>
     
        <div class="champ">
          <label for="profession">Profession : 
          </label>
          <input type="text" name="profession" id="profession" value="[[!+fi.profession]]" />
        </div>
    
        <div class="champ">
          <label for="societe">Société : 
          </label>
          <input type="text" name="societe" id="societe" value="[[!+fi.societe]]" />
        </div>
     
        <div class="champ">
          <label for="message">Détaillez votre demande : 
              <span class="error">[[!+fi.error.message]]</span>
          </label>
          <textarea id="message" name="message" value="[[!+fi.message]]" rows="7" style="width:400px;"></textarea>
        </div>
    
        <div class="champ checkbox">
          <label for="newsletter" style="width:550px">Je souhaite recevoir les newsletters de Street Finances : 
          </label>
          <input type="checkbox" name="newsletter[]" value="oui" [[!+fi.newsletter:FormItIsChecked=`oui`]] />
        </div>
     
        <br class="clear" />
     
        <div class="form-buttons">
            <input type="image" value="Envoyez" src="images/btn-envoyez.jpg" />
        </div>
    </form>


    I know FormItAutoResponder is running as I receive the autoresponder e-mail.
    How can I check if &fiarFrom is well processed ?